We’ve said it before and we’ll say it again: Jim Maresh knows a thing or two about wine.
As the third-generation in his family to make wine, Jim crafts Grand Cru-level Willamette Valley Pinot Noir and Chardonnay from the winery’s prized position in the Dundee Hills. His releases are praised by critics praise as “are some of the most impressive wines I’ve tried anywhere—not just in the US”, per Erin Brooks of the Wine Advocate.
The winery in question? Arterberry Maresh.
These are benchmark wines for the region that somehow capture Jim’s easy-going yet seriously-nerdy-under-the-skin personality.
That dualistic charm is doubled in in experimental side project, Tan Fruit. Now, you could assume that the wines are throwaway gags not meant to see the light of day, but leave it to Jim to make his side project a points-sweeping EVENT. Wine Advocate gushed over the first releases from 2019, granting the wines top marks for Oregon whites in the vintage, and subsequent releases have been equally praised. Tan Fruit expertly explores different vineyard sources, winemaking techniques, and picking dates, while mixing barrel and steel, malo- and non-, from the Columbia Valley to Umpqua. It’s like he followed every possible path of a flowchart and made each result delicious.

Erin Brooks-Wine Advocate 95 points “The 2022 Chardonnay Maresh Vineyard comes from a block of Dijon clone vines planted in 1991 in the Dundee Hills on a steep, south-facing slope at 675 feet of elevation. Barrel fermented and matured for 10 months in 15% new French oak, plus four months in stainless steel, it’s reminiscent of Chablis and boasts exceptionally pure aromas. It opens with flint and petrichor before blossoming to apricot, elderflower liqueur, lime peel and hazelnuts. The palate is vibrant and silky with understated layers of creamy, peachy fruit, and its linear acidity and flinty tones come together for a shimmery finish. For several days after it’s opened, the Maresh Vineyard becomes more and more expressive, pointing to a long life in the cellar.”

Gaja is an iconic producer in the world of wine. What DRC is to Burgundy, Gaja’s cru bottlings are to Piedmont—they are the wines that put the region on the modern wine collector’s map, desirable long before anything else in their appellation was.
